There is a severity factor proposed by Cedergren, which measures the relative damage of pavement performance between dry and wet conditions. For a pavement section with a moderate severity factor of 10, if 10% of the time is saturated, the service life can be reduced by half:<\/p>\n<p>&nbsp;<\/p>\n<div id=\"attachment_7376\" style=\"width: 631px\" class=\"wp-caption aligncenter\"><img alt=\"Gr\u00e1fico vida \u00fatil pavimento seg\u00fan factor severidad\" loading=\"lazy\" decoding=\"async\" aria-describedby=\"caption-attachment-7376\" class=\"wp-image-7376\" src=\"https:\/\/geomatrix.sfo2.cdn.digitaloceanspaces.com\/web\/Captura-de-pantalla-2025-05-27-a-las-4.00.50%E2%80%AFp.m-300x200.jpg\" width=\"621\" height=\"414\" srcset=\"https:\/\/geomatrix.sfo2.cdn.digitaloceanspaces.com\/web\/Captura-de-pantalla-2025-05-27-a-las-4.00.50%E2%80%AFp.m-300x200.jpg 300w, https:\/\/geomatrix.sfo2.cdn.digitaloceanspaces.com\/web\/Captura-de-pantalla-2025-05-27-a-las-4.00.50%E2%80%AFp.m-1024x683.jpg 1024w, https:\/\/geomatrix.sfo2.cdn.digitaloceanspaces.com\/web\/Captura-de-pantalla-2025-05-27-a-las-4.00.50%E2%80%AFp.m-768x512.jpg 768w, https:\/\/geomatrix.sfo2.cdn.digitaloceanspaces.com\/web\/Captura-de-pantalla-2025-05-27-a-las-4.00.50%E2%80%AFp.m-1536x1024.jpg 1536w, https:\/\/geomatrix.sfo2.cdn.digitaloceanspaces.com\/web\/Captura-de-pantalla-2025-05-27-a-las-4.00.50%E2%80%AFp.m-18x12.jpg 18w, https:\/\/geomatrix.sfo2.cdn.digitaloceanspaces.com\/web\/Captura-de-pantalla-2025-05-27-a-las-4.00.50%E2%80%AFp.m.jpg 1542w\" sizes=\"auto, (max-width: 621px) 100vw, 621px\"><p id=\"caption-attachment-7376\" class=\"wp-caption-text\"><strong>Figure 2.<\/strong> Service life of a pavement with respect to the time that the section is saturated<br \/>(Source: Cedergren, H.R. 1987, <a href=\"https:\/\/trid.trb.org\/View\/405670\">Drainage of highway and airfield pavements<\/a>Robert E Krieger Publishing Co, FL).<\/p><\/div>\n<p>&nbsp;<\/p>\n<p>He <strong>longitudinal underdrain <\/strong>is in charge of capturing flows converging horizontally and guiding them in a direction parallel to the road.<\/p>\n<p>He <strong>transverse underdrainage <\/strong>is in charge of capturing upward water flows and conveying them to the longitudinal underdrainage system. The most representative ones are listed below:<\/p>\n<ol>\n<li><strong>Improved soil stability:<\/strong><\/li>\n<\/ol>\n<p><strong>\u00a0<\/strong>Controls the water table and excess groundwater that can cause differential settlement or landslides, especially in sloping or unstable terrain. Underdrain stabilizes the ground and prevents structural failure.<\/p>\n<ol>\n<li><strong>Prolongation of pavement life: <\/strong><\/li>\n<\/ol>\n<p>Water is one of the factors that deteriorate roads the most. If it accumulates in the subgrade, it weakens the granular layers of the pavement, causing deformations, cracks and potholes. A good subgrade system prevents this damage by keeping the supporting soil dry.<\/p>\n<ol>\n<li><strong>Reduced maintenance costs:<\/strong><\/li>\n<\/ol>\n<p>By avoiding severe structural damage to the pavement, the frequency and magnitude of necessary repairs is reduced, resulting in significant long-term savings.<\/p>\n<ol>\n<li><strong>Improves the functioning of surface drainage
